Hogan and Brayshaw don't make the list because it's based on 2017 performance.

And for those wondering about the age of the players the article makes quite clear that player must be 22 or under for the whole of the season, including finals. In other words, anyone who doesn't have their 23rd birthday until  Sunday 1 October is eligible for consideration.
